Synopsis of the role We are looking for a Technical Product Manager (TPM) to own and elevate our digital channels ecosystem (Web, Mobile, and API integrations). In this role, you will bridge the gap between complex system architecture and seamless user experiences. This is a highly collaborative role: you will partner directly with our Line of Business (LOB) Product Managers, who own the overarching business vision and customer value proposition. While the LOB PMs define the what and the why from a business perspective, you will own the how , translating their vision into a scalable technical roadmap, managing channel-specific capabilities, and ensuring a high performing digital experience. What You’ll Do Manage the Roadmap: Partner closely with LOB Product Managers to co-create, negotiate, and maintain the digital channels roadmap. You will turn business vision into executable requirements and release plans. Bridge Vision and Execution: Act as the primary strategic link between LOB business leads and the engineering team. Translate business-line goals into clear specifications, user stories, and API requirements. Manage Dependencies & Tradeoffs: Evaluate LOB feature requests against channel constraints, technical debt, and platform scalability. Proactively negotiate tradeoffs when business vision collides with technical reality. API & Platform Thinking: Ensure backend services and APIs are built with a platform mindset, scalable, reusable, and optimized to support multiple LOB goals across web and mobile touchpoints. Optimize Channel Performance: Use data analytics and technical telemetry to ensure the digital channels are fast, secure, and intuitive, safeguarding the user journey defined by the LOBs. Technical Grooming & Prioritization: Lead agile ceremonies for the channel delivery teams, managing a ruthlessly prioritized backlog that balances LOB innovation with architectural health.
